The Weight of Expectation and the Thrill of Home Support
the British Grand Prix carries a unique weight for any british driver. The expectation from the passionate home fans is immense, a constant hum of support that can be both exhilarating and daunting. Norris, having grown up in the UK and with a notable fanbase, feels this acutely.He has spoken about how the cheers of the crowd, particularly through the fast sweeps of Maggotts, Becketts, and Copse, provide an unbelievable boost. This home support is not just about cheering; it’s about a shared passion for the sport and a collective hope for success.

The Emotional Connection to Silverstone
Beyond the technical aspects of racing and the pursuit of results, Silverstone holds a deep emotional significance for Lando Norris. It’s a place where he has grown up watching motorsport, dreaming of one day competing at the highest level. The circuit represents the culmination of years of dedication, sacrifice, and passion.
Childhood Dreams and the Reality of Racing at Home
Norris has often recounted his childhood memories of attending the British Grand Prix as a spectator. The sights, sounds, and sheer excitement of the event ignited his passion for motorsport and set him on the path he follows today.To now be competing at Silverstone, not just as a participant but as a leading contender, is the realization of those childhood dreams. This personal connection adds an extra layer of intensity and meaning to his participation in the event.
